Albuquerque Raymond G. Murphy VA Healthcare System in Albuquerque, NM is hiring for a Diagnostic Radiologic Technologist to serve as our Magnetic Resonance Safety Officer (MRSO). The MRSO operates with full responsibility for training, developing, and directing the Magnetic Resonance (MR) safety program within the Diagnostic Imaging service department. Total Rewards of a Allied Health Professional Serves as operator of a super conductive magnetic resource imaging unit. The operator will develop new techniques, define optimal protocols, and devise alternative ways to visualize pathology within the patient. Interaction with physicians, physicists, computer programs, and biomed engineers will be a normal occurrence of the daily duties of the operator. Duties include, but not limited to: * Coordination of Magnetic Resonance (MR) safety committee meetings * Evaluation of hospital equipment to ensure Magnetic Resonance (MR) safe operation * Oversight of employee and patient Magnetic Resonance (MR) screening programs * Coordinates training of hospital staff and ensures maintenance of educational documentation.
